Transaction 09778939de4bf9454290347e588fe23c8e66fd3183458ba11d1f516e6151c079

2 Input
2 Outputs
  • 09778939de4bf9454290347e588fe23c8e66fd3183458ba11d1f516e6151c079:0
  • value  10819195
    address  33J2DVT57Tvgb41PneF19dtMGU4925tX4J
  • 09778939de4bf9454290347e588fe23c8e66fd3183458ba11d1f516e6151c079:1
  • value  50000000
    address  1JRQTjHAhyPxjPC9iJWq2FA6sdzLbZQ4i2